MHAC will appoint new members to a three year term. Members serve three 3 year terms and have voting privileges.
MHAC Membership is a volunteer position. Members are expected to commit an average of 20 hours every three months to fulfill their obligation to MHAC.
Applicants are asked to complete the entire application, including Parts I, II, and III. Demographic information will be used to ensure the body is diverse across expertise and identities, and also reflective of the epidemic. Twenty-five percent (25%) of MHAC seats are set aside for persons living with HIV/AIDS.
Confidentiality: The information provided on this application will be held in confidence by the membership committee of MHAC. All material containing confidential information is shredded after a voting quarter. MHAC strives to maintain a diverse membership that represents those living with HIV/AIDS and those affected by HIV in Michigan per CDC guidelines. While applicants may choose not to provide certain information, applications will be scored based on the information provided. We encourage you to complete all questions in the application. Leaving questions unanswered, vague, or incomplete may impact your overall application score.
